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7797283 151191 345 3510280973
0158634 583551767 55046282
0158634 583551767 55046282
2750 1973085 7666 88
All about undefined
Interested in learning more?
0158634 583551767 55046282
2750 1973085 7666 88
See more
8526757050 3109440137
143 697 5399546
See more
261784 40773 89036009
224482 3859822971 419304711
See more